During DST, clocks are turned forward an hour, effectively moving an hour of daylight from the morning to the evening.

Beginning in 2007, most of the United States begins Daylight Saving Time at 2:00 a.m. on the second Sunday in March and reverts to standard time on the first Sunday in November. In the U.S., each time zone switches at a different time.
